Body Wash Introduction and its Market Analysis
Body wash is a liquid soap product used for cleansing the body. The target market for body wash includes both men and women of all ages who desire a convenient and hygienic way to clean their skin. Major factors driving revenue growth in the body wash market include increasing awareness of personal hygiene, changing consumer preferences for luxurious skincare products, and the availability of a wide range of fragrances and formulations. Companies operating in the body wash market, such as Johnson & Johnson, L’Oreal, P&G, and Unilever, are focusing on product innovation, marketing strategies, and mergers & acquisitions to maintain their competitive edge. Top Featured Companies Dominating the Global Body Wash Market
The body wash market is highly competitive with key players including Johnson & Johnson, L'Oreal, P&G, Unilever, Colgate-Palmolive, Avon, Bath and Body Works, Beiersdorf, Coty, Estee Lauder, Henkel, Kao, L’Occitane, Lush, Revlon, Soap and Glory.
These companies offer a wide range of body wash products to cater to different consumer preferences such as moisturizing, exfoliating, sensitive skin, natural ingredients, etc. They invest in research and development to innovate and create new formulations and fragrances to attract customers.
Johnson & Johnson, for example, offers body wash products under its brands like Aveeno, Neutrogena, and Johnson's. L'Oreal sells body wash under its brands like L'Oreal Paris and Garnier. P&G offers body wash products under brands like Olay and Old Spice. Unilever has brands like Dove and Axe.
Companies like Beiersdorf, maker of Nivea, and Henkel, maker of Dial and Fa, also have a strong presence in the market. Competitive pricing, effective marketing strategies, and product variations help companies grow in the body wash market.

Body Wash Market Analysis, by Type:
- Dry Skin
- Oily Skin
- Mixed Skin
- Other
Dry skin body washes contain hydrating ingredients like shea butter and glycerin to moisturize and nourish the skin. Oily skin body washes have clarifying ingredients such as salicylic acid to control excess oil and prevent breakouts. Mixed skin body washes are formulated with a balanced mix of hydrating and clarifying ingredients to address both skin types. Other types include sensitive skin body washes, which are gentle and soothing for delicate skin. The variety of body wash options cater to different skin needs, boosting demand in the market as more consumers seek personalized skincare solutions.
